Full Specs Comparison

Spec Oura Ring Gen 3 WHOOP 4.0
Form Factor Ring (finger-worn) Wristband
Sensors PPG, NTC temp, accelerometer, gyroscope PPG, accelerometer, gyroscope, skin conductance
Heart Rate Monitoring Continuous HR + HRV Continuous HR + HRV (every 2 min)
Sleep Tracking Sleep stages, deep/REM/light/awake Sleep stages, respiratory rate, sleep disturbances
Recovery Score Readiness Score (0–100) Recovery Score (0–100, daily coach)
Strain Score Activity Score Strain Score (0–21) — better for workouts
Subscription $5.99/month (basic data free) $30/month mandatory — device “free”
Battery Life 4–7 days 4–5 days
Waterproof Water resistant to 100m Water resistant to 1.5m
Weight 4–6 g (barely noticeable) ~34 g
Price $299–$549 (+ optional $5.99/mo) $0 device (but $30/month required)

Oura Ring Gen 3

  • ✓ Ring form — invisible, no screen, no sleep disturbance
  • ✓ 100m water resistance
  • ✓ Period prediction (menstrual cycle tracking)
  • ✓ No mandatory subscription ($5.99/mo optional)
  • ✓ Better sleep data granularity
  • ✗ No real-time HR display
  • ✗ No workout strain tracking as robust as WHOOP
  • ✗ Ring sizing can be tricky

WHOOP 4.0

  • ✓ Best workout strain tracking available
  • ✓ Continuous HRV (not just during sleep)
  • ✓ WHOOP Coach AI provides daily recommendations
  • ✓ Worn 24/7 seamlessly during workouts
  • ✓ No screen — pure data device
  • ✗ $30/month MANDATORY — $360/year forever
  • ✗ Lower water resistance (1.5m vs 100m)
  • ✗ Wristband less discreet than ring
  • ✗ Device is “free” but costs $360/yr to use

Final Verdict

The true cost comparison reveals the winner: Oura Ring Gen 3 at $299 + optional $5.99/month vs WHOOP 4.0 at $0 device but mandatory $30/month ($360/year). After Year 1, WHOOP has cost $360 with no sign of stopping; Oura’s total is $372 or less with better sleep tracking and a form factor you’ll actually forget you’re wearing. WHOOP wins for serious athletes who need workout strain coaching. For health-conscious people who prioritize sleep quality and hate subscriptions: Oura.
